The research background of the gas-liquid reaction process intensification at micro-/nano-mesoscale is comprehensively discussed, and the key scientific issues and research ideas of the medium dispersion mechanism in the micro-/nano-mesoscale are analyzed. Taking HiGee and membrane reactors as examples, the current fundamental research progresses of gas-liquid reaction process intensification at micro-/nano-mesoscale and the potential industrial application in China are summarized. The future development direction is also proposed.
